Vintage 50’s A-2 model flight jacket

The famous A-2 model flight jacket originally was designed and issued by the US Army to Air Force pilots, navigators and bombardiers during WWII. After the war the A-2 became very populair, worn in many TV shows and movies by famous actors many manufactorers began to reproduce the jacket for casual use in the 50’s & 60’s.
It never came out of style and still remains an American style icon!
